What Is a Root Canal Treatment? A root canal is a procedure used to treat infection inside a tooth. When the pulp becomes infected due to deep decay, cracks, or injury, it can lead to severe pain and even tooth loss if left untreated. During a root canal treatment, your dentist: Removes the infected pulp Cleans and disinfects the inner canals Fills and seals the tooth Restores it with a crown for strength This process helps save your natural tooth, making it a reliable option for Tooth Preservation in One Day in many cases. https://youtube.com/shorts/xkUmVzJZ5wY?si=xpKYMdohG9zG3Jkw Are Root Canals Painful? Let’s Clear the Myth The biggest misconception is that root canals are painful. In reality, the procedure itself is designed to eliminate pain. The truth is simple: The area is fully numbed using local anesthesia You may feel slight pressure, but no sharp pain The experience is similar to getting a dental filling Most patients who undergo root canal treatment in Jaipur clinics report immediate relief from the intense toothache caused by infection. Common reasons include: Old dental practices that were less advanced Hearing exaggerated experiences from others Waiting too long before getting treatment Confusing infection pain with treatment pain In reality, the pain you feel before treatment is due to infection, not the procedure itself. What Happens During a Root Canal Procedure? Knowing what to expect can reduce anxiety and help you feel more confident. Step-by-step process: 1. Diagnosis and X-rays: The dentist examines your tooth and confirms the infection. 2. Local Anesthesia: The area is numbed to ensure a painless experience. 3. Cleaning the Canals: The infected pulp is removed, and the canals are thoroughly cleaned. 4. Filling and Sealing: The tooth is filled with a special material to prevent reinfection. 5. Final Restoration: A crown is placed to restore strength and function. With advanced technology, many clinics now offer Tooth Preservation in One Day, completing the procedure quickly and efficiently. Does It Hurt After a Root Canal? After the procedure, you may experience mild discomfort for a short time. Common post-treatment symptoms: Slight sensitivity while chewing Mild soreness in the treated area Temporary gum tenderness How to manage it: Take prescribed pain relief medication Avoid hard foods for a few days Maintain proper oral hygiene This discomfort usually fades within a couple of days, especially when treated at a reputed clinic offering root canal treatment in Jaipur. When Do You Need a Root Canal? You may require a root canal if you notice: Severe or persistent toothache Sensitivity to hot or cold Swelling or tenderness in the gums Tooth discoloration Pus or infection signs If you experience these symptoms, don’t delay. Early treatment can help with Tooth Preservation in One Day in many cases. Root Canal vs Tooth Extraction: Many patients think removing the tooth is easier, but saving it is usually the better option. Root Canal: Preserves natural tooth Maintains jawbone strength Long-lasting solution Extraction: Requires replacement (implant or bridge) Higher long-term cost May affect nearby teeth A root canal treatment is a more conservative and effective approach. In this comprehensive guide, we will explore the types of dental implants, their benefits, costs, procedure, tips, and FAQs to help you make an informed decision. What Are Dental Implants? Dental Implants are artificial tooth roots, typically made of titanium, placed into the jawbone to support a crown, bridge, or denture. They provide a Permanent Tooth Replacement option that looks and feels like natural teeth. Unlike traditional dentures, dental implants prevent bone loss and maintain facial structure. Benefits of Dental Implants Natural look and feel Long-lasting solution Prevents bone loss Improves chewing and speech Protects adjacent teeth Whether you’re considering a single tooth replacement or a full mouth restoration, choosing a reputable dental implant clinic in Jaipur ensures safety and long-term results. Types of Dental Implants Dental implants come in several types, each designed to meet different needs. Your dentist will recommend the best option depending on your oral health, bone structure, and aesthetic goals. 1. Endosteal Implants Endosteal implants are the most common type. They are surgically placed directly into the jawbone. Features: Shaped like screws, cylinders, or blades Usually requires two stages: implant placement and crown attachment Suitable for most patients with a healthy jawbone Ideal for: Single tooth replacement Multiple tooth replacement using bridges Example: A patient at Royal Dental Clinics and Hospital, Jaipur, received an endosteal implant for a missing front tooth, achieving a natural smile within a few months. 2. Subperiosteal Implants Subperiosteal implants are placed under the gum but above the jawbone. Features: Used for patients with insufficient bone Typically supported by a metal frame Less common today due to advancements in bone grafting Ideal for: Patients who cannot undergo bone augmentation Individuals looking for a less invasive procedure Tip: Choosing a skilled implantologist is crucial as subperiosteal implants require precise placement. 3. Zygomatic Implants Zygomatic implants are longer implants anchored in the cheekbone (zygoma). Features: Used when the upper jawbone is insufficient Often eliminates the need for bone grafts Complex procedure requiring expert hands Ideal for: Severe bone loss in the upper jaw Full-arch restorations Note: Only highly experienced implantologists, such as the team at Royal Dental Clinics and Hospital, Jaipur, should perform this procedure. Oral Cancer Rehabilitation Royal Dental Clinic and Hospital Call Now Get in Touch 4. Mini Dental Implants Mini implants are smaller in diameter compared to traditional implants. Features: Less invasive Can be placed in narrow jaw spaces Often used to stabilize dentures Ideal for: Patients seeking Dental Implants in One Day Temporary or transitional solutions Tip: Mini implants are cost-effective but may not be suitable for permanent tooth replacement in all cases. 5. Immediate Load Implants Immediate load implants allow a crown or bridge to be placed immediately after implant insertion. Features: Commonly known as same-day implants Reduces treatment time Requires sufficient bone density Ideal for: Patients looking for fast results Individuals with good oral health and bone structure Example: Many patients visiting a dental implant clinic in Jaipur prefer immediate load implants to avoid months of waiting for a tooth replacement.
